‘Aspects Of Local History’, a seminar with 3 keynote speakers, took place in The First Fruits Arts Centre in Watergrasshill last Sunday evening.

The 3 speakers at the event were Eamon Cotter (Rathcormac), Christy Roche (Grange) and John Arnold (Bartlemy). Eamon spoke about the region’s archaeology, pre-Christian settlements and the results of local archaeological digs. John Arnold recalled the wealth of folklore about east Cork, while author, Christy Roche, provided the historical background to Watergrasshill and its environs.

MC for this free event was Barry Curtin. Watergrasshill’s sporting past was recalled by Batt McHugh, in conversation with Barry. The seminar was enjoyed by a large crowd, who were informed and entertained by the various speakers.
